Welsh nationalism is a political movement advocating for the recognition and promotion of Welsh identity, language, culture, and autonomy.
Key Features
- Promotion of Welsh language and culture
- Advocacy for Welsh independence or increased autonomy
- Historical grievances with English dominance
- Support for devolution and self-governance
